一、系统概述与技术架构设计
自助建站系统采用分层架构设计,包含前端界面层、业务逻辑层和数据存储层。前端基于React框架实现可视化编辑,结合Bootstrap网格系统实现响应式布局。后端使用Node.js构建RESTful API,通过MongoDB进行模板配置和用户数据存储。
| 层级 | 技术方案 |
|---|---|
| 前端框架 | React + Ant Design |
| 后端语言 | Node.js + Express |
| 数据库 | MongoDB + Redis缓存 |
二、核心功能模块开发
系统包含六大核心模块:
- 模板管理系统
支持HTML/CSS模板的动态加载与版本控制 - 可视化编辑器
实现拖拽式组件布局与实时预览 - 用户权限系统
基于RBAC模型的权限管理体系 - 多终端适配模块
自动生成PC/移动端双版本代码 - SEO优化模块
自动生成元标签和结构化数据 - 发布部署系统
支持一键式域名绑定与CDN加速
三、系统开发与部署流程
采用敏捷开发模式,具体实施流程包括:
- 需求分析阶段:建立用户场景矩阵
- 架构设计阶段:绘制UML组件交互图
- 模块开发阶段:实现前后端分离开发
- 系统集成测试:执行跨浏览器兼容性测试
- 自动化部署:配置CI/CD流水线
复制本文链接文章为作者独立观点不代表优设网立场,未经允许不得转载。
文章推荐更多>
- 1夸克api接口的使用教程 夸克api接口调用方法详解
- 2台式电脑怎么连接wifi 台式机无线网络连接步骤
- 3怎么安装帝国cms
- 4夸克怎么转存115 115资源转存方法分享
- 5wordpress怎么生成app
- 6wordpress网站怎么设置不可被复制
- 7 网站制作报价单模板图片,小松挖机官方网站报价?
- 8sql触发器的三种触发方式
- 9phpmyadmin怎么创建表
- 10yandex引擎一个无需登录 yandex引擎二个无需登录
- 11华为uc浏览器的缓存视频怎么导出
- 12电脑蓝屏0x000000c2 蓝屏代码0x000000c2的解决方法
- 13oracle误删除表怎么办
- 14c盘满了怎么清理垃圾而不误删 安全清理c盘垃圾的4个步骤
- 15电脑截屏是按哪三个键 三键组合截屏操作教学
- 16夸克怎么查询浏览记录 夸克历史记录查看方式
- 17wordpress怎么从数据库获取数据
- 18oracle数据库如何查看表结构
- 19零日漏洞防御:实时监控CVE与沙箱分析
- 20电脑黑屏啥也不显示怎么办 彻底黑屏故障排查全面修复指南
- 21ao3官方网站链接最新 ao3官方网站最新链接
- 22wordpress如何判断是否为手机移动设备
- 23oracle如何修改端口
- 24高端建站如何打造兼具美学与转化的品牌官网?
- 25phpmyadmin关联视图在哪
- 26华为UC浏览器视频导出U盘
- 27华为手机UC缓存视频导出步骤
- 28phpmyadmin怎么设置自增
- 29redis的五种数据类型有哪些组成
- 30oracle怎么设置定时任务
